Prime Minister, Viorica Dancila, stated on Thursday at the meeting with the Social-Democrat pensioners, that she will not resign as long as she has the support of the Social Democratic Party (PSD, major at rule, ed.n.) leader Liviu Dragnea and that of the governing coalition (PSD-ALDE, the Alliance of Liberals and Democrats, minor at rule, ed.n.).
"I saw today or yesterday that the estimates of the National Institute of Statistics (INS) were released and I saw that we have economic growth, the fact that Romania is on a good path, and this good path Romania is moving along is backed by the governing programme, is supported by you, Romania's pensioners. That is why I was expecting that for this result - just like when you get good grades - to be rewarded. It seems like not everybody thinks that way. I therefore feel compelled to tell you here, at the National Council of the Social Democratic Party's Organization of Pensioners, that under no circumstance will I resign, not as long as I have the support of the party's leader, as long as I am backed by the ruling coalition and I have your support," premier Viorica Dancila said at the National Council of the Social Democratic Party's Organization of Pensioners' meeting.
